WebPeriod 3 metal oxides tend to have high melting points while the non-metal oxides have low melting points. The non-metal oxide SiO 2 is a giant covalent macromolecule and has a … WebVariation in physical properties in period 3 Melting and boiling points In a moment we shall explain all the ups and downs in this graph. Electrical conductivity Sodium, magnesium and aluminium are all good conductors of electricity. Silicon is a semiconductor. None of the rest conduct electricity. WebThe melting point from \text{Na}_2\text{O} to \text{Al}_2\text{O}_3 increases due to the increased charge of the cation, which makes the electrostatic forces even stronger. \text{SiO}_2 is a macromolecular oxide, so it has a lot of very strong covalent bonds.
